抑郁症中医辨证特点及S-ET分析的临床研究

摘    要:目的: 通过高级脑电神经递质分析(S-ET)系统脑功能检测,对抑郁症患者脑内5-羟色胺(5-HT),乙酰胆碱(Ach)、多巴胺(DA)、去甲肾上腺素(NE)、强抑制介质(INH)、强兴奋递质(EXC)功能变化检测,为抑郁症的诊断提供客观依据。 方法: 收集抑郁症患者244例,中医辨证分为5个证型,正常人为71例,进行脑功能S-ET检测。 结果: 抑郁症患者与正常人之间的S-ET存在差异,其5-HT,ACH,DA,NE,EXC神经递质均值低于正常人(P<0.05)。中医不同证型之间及其与正常人的S-ET均存在显著差异(P<0.05)。 结论: 抑郁症患者的脑功能S-ET表现与正常人不同,其发病机制并不是某神经递质功能的全部低下或者全部亢进。

TCM Syndrome Differentiation of Depression and the Clinical S-Et Analysis

Abstract:Objective: To provide objective basis for diagnosis of depression by Supper EEG Technology (S-Et) and determination of neurotransmitters, such as 5-HT, acetylcholine, dopamine, norepinephrine. Method: 244 of depression patients and 71 normal controls were involved in the study. TCM syndrome differentiation, S-ET and neurotransmitters determination were applied to the cases. Result: The comparison showed that depression patients and normal controls had significant differences in 5-HT, ACH, DA NE and EXC(p<0.01, with lowered levels in the patients). There were also marked differences in S-ET between TCM syndromes and normal controls (p<0.05). Conclusion: The brain function of depression demonstrated by S-ET is different from the normal persons. The mechanism of depression is not a simple elevation or decrease in all the neurotransmitters.
